16 is std marks on a t5
but turn your stator clockwise a mill or so and it will be nearer 14

Ran mine @ - 1.5mm btd on the Scooterotica scale - 15.5 BTDC degrees on the degree scale. Solid for full throttle 100 Miles an another. 172, PM head, reed Phbh set-up etc. Only retard from the the 16 mark on a T5 if your head is unaltered per Std Malossi kit! (or u r pinking) IMHO
I've got 3 Malossi 172 and run em all at standard setting 16 degrees.
Covered thousands of miles over the years.
Never missed a beat.
